Meerapur - Bisauli, Budaun
Meerapur is a village situated in the Bisauli tehsil of Budaun district, Uttar Pradesh. It is located approximately 21 km from the tehsil headquarters in Besauli and around 28 km from the district headquarters in Badaoun. Meerapur village is a designated Gram Panchayat.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Meerapur is 127672. The village covers a total geographical area of 134.55 hectares and falls under the 243726 pincode.
Meerapur village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Budaun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Badaun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.
Population of Meerapur
As per Census 2011, Meerapur village has a total population of 1,434 people, consisting of 774 males and 660 females. The village has 263 households and a sex ratio of 852 females per 1,000 males. There are 253 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 640 literate and 794 illiterate residents. Additionally, 455 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Meerapur
Meerapur is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through shared auto-rickshaws. The nearest railway station is Reoti Bahora Khera, while the nearest airport is Pantnagar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 83.0 km.
